Transaction 5fc3929607624b365f508803e56c6d556879e65492402989174319092a6923ca
1 Input
2 Outputs
- 5fc3929607624b365f508803e56c6d556879e65492402989174319092a6923ca:0
- 5fc3929607624b365f508803e56c6d556879e65492402989174319092a6923ca:1
value 21968070
address 36k4ZB9pTzGCwh5KVTZV1MNE1EXkVESAnM
value 1586126
address 35fa1UBFdSwFYN3MrMAd3rGiPZbARcekEV